- [ ] Before the Quillhaven signing ceremony proceeds, run the leaked-file-descriptor hunt on the offline signer. As a new contractor, please be thorough: enumerate every open descriptor on the sealed host, confirm nothing points at the ceremony scratch volume, and log each finding in the Larkspur register. If any descriptor traces back to the retired Fenwick exporter, halt and page the ceremony lead. Once the host shows a clean descriptor table, unlock the escrow envelope using the phrase below.

unlock words, yajof-tagef: aldiel-kasath-briax-fraeth-pelius-olieth-pelix-wenius-wenael-norael

Subject: On-call access to tailcat

Welcome to the rotation. We use tailcat, an internal CLI, to stream service logs during incidents. It reads only from the Fennwick log gateway and respects per-team ACLs, so no raw host access is needed. Before your first shift, review the setup guide on our internal page.

wiki page, tahaf-tajog: https://jira.ordindyn.corp/pipeline

# Veridane Validator Plugins — Environments

Veridane runs three environments: sandbox, staging, and production. Plugin authors should develop against sandbox, where validator registration is self-service and schema errors are non-fatal. Staging mirrors production quotas and enforces signature checks on plugin bundles. Promotion between environments is automated nightly. For reference, the staging environment currently runs with the following configuration values.

service settings:
[oliix]
team = noveth
access_code = ac_4de949
host = oliix.novachq.corp
port = 8080
owner = wenir.casion
peer = wenys.lumicstack.corp

Subject: Cut-over complete — Marrowgate incremental rebuilds

Hi Petra,

The cut-over to incremental static rebuilds on the Marrowgate site finished last night without rollback. Median publish time dropped from eleven minutes to roughly forty seconds, and the content team has already confirmed edits propagate correctly. Two caveats: template changes still force a full rebuild, and the cache warmer lags by about a minute after deploys. Please verify your local tooling matches production; the live values are listed here:

config for hahaf-kafof:
[wenys]
host = wenys.torvahq.corp
user = wenys_svc
database = wenys_prod